Day 1 : International outbound flight
Today you begin your journey by boarding your international outbound flight to Auckland.
Day 2 : International outbound flight
On-board your international outbound flight to Auckland.
Day 3 : Auckland
Upon arrival in Auckland you will be welcomed by one of our representatives and transferred by private vehicle to your accommodation in the central city.
Day 4 : Auckland
Today you join an excursion that takes you to the hidden spots of Auckland city, the rugged Waitakere Ranges, just outside of Auckland, and then on to the beautiful black sand beaches of the western shores. Your Maori guide will explain the cultural significance of the area on this fascinating day out.
Day 5 : Coromandel Peninsula
You collect a hire car from the downtown depot this morning and make your way to the Coromandel Peninsula. You can either take the more direct route through the mountain ranges of the Coromandel Peninsula which takes around two and a half hours or drive round the longer coastal road to see the stunning coastline and stop in at the Coromandel Mussel Kitchen for lunch, then visit Stuart and his wild pigs on the 309 road. The coastal drive takes around five hours but is not to be missed!
Day 6 : Coromandel Peninsula
You have today at leisure to enjoy the Coromandel area. Don't miss Hot Water Beach and Cathedral Cove! If you took the direct road over yesterday we suggest exploring the coastal road today.
Day 7 : Whakatane
Make your way along the Bay of Plenty to Whakatane where you will spend tonight before your exciting trip to the active volcano of White Island.
Day 8 : Whakatane
Today you take a boat trip out to White Island and spend some time walking around the rugged terrain at the base with your guide, there may even be time for a swim at the end of the trip.
Day 9 : Gisborne
You make your way through scenic Waioeka Gorge today across to the southern coast, and the laid-back town of Gisborne.
Day 10 : Gisborne
Enjoy a day at leisure exploring some of the beautiful white sand beaches along the eastern coast. This is a great place to try your hand at surfing!
Day 11 : Napier & Hawkes Bay
Make your way along the coast to Hastings in the Hawkes Bay wine region today. This evening you will enjoy the best wine tour in the area, where you visit several wineries. You will be served a tasting menu dinner throughout the evening, with one course accompanied by beautifully paired wines at each location.
Day 12 : Napier & Hawkes Bay
A day at leisure to enjoy the art deco city of Napier and the surrounding vineyards of Hawkes Bay. You may like to join an Art Deco tour of the town or visit the gannet colony at Cape Kidnappers.
Day 13 : Tongariro National Park
You head inland today to the volcanic interior of the North Island, and three peaks of Tongariro, Ngauruhoe and Ruapehu that make up Tongariro National Park.
Day 14 : Tongariro National Park
You have a day at leisure and weather permitting may like to try the famous Tongariro Alpine Crossing walk today. For something less strenuous take a more leisurely stroll in the National Park or ride the chair-lift up to the top for some spectacular views.
Day 15 : New Plymouth & Taranaki
You journey along the 'Forgotten World Highway' today, a scenic drive through some very rural landscapes which brings you out on the eastern side of Taranaki (Egmont) National Park.
Day 16 : New Plymouth & Taranaki
Enjoy a day exploring the slopes of Mount Taranaki, or enjoying views of the volcano from the beaches around New Plymouth.
Day 17 : Waitomo
Today you make your way to Waitomo, and take a tour around the famous glow-worm caves.
